Comes with 'jumplead' style cables to connect to the Battery, but i want to run it off the cig lighter.

Is this possible?

Because i 'fashioned' a cable to connect it into the lighter socket but im not getting any power :(

Straight from the Battery it works fine, not a sausage when plugged into the lighter though.

And i've tested the lighter with a few things before and after trying the invertor so there isnt anything wrong with the socket and i havent blown a fuse.

Is there something im missing? I think maybe its just a duff cable i've made up.

you'll fry the wiring probably!

assuming fuse is 10A,

Power = Volts x Current = 12 * 10 = 120W (which is well below what you want)

Also, in the starlet (not sure about your car) the interior light, radio and cigarette lighter are all on the same circuit so best to hardwire it.
